Haidarpur

Haidarpur is a village located in Kairana tehsil of Muzaffarnag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Kairana (tehsildar office) and 15km away from district headquarter Muzaffarnagar. As per 2009 stats, Mawi is the gram panchayat of Haidarpur village.

About Haidarp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Haidarpur is 110595. The village spans a total geographical area of 110.95 hectares. Kairana is nearest town to Haidarp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Haidarpur

According to the 2011 Census, Haidarpur has a total population of about 360, with approximately 190 males and 170 females. The sex ratio is around 894 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 53 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 67.50%, with male literacy at about 78.95% and female literacy near 54.71%. Connectivity of Haidarp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Haidarpur. As per the 2011 stats, Haidarp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
